I am an AVG fan myself. It has a smaller footprint on the hd and ram - updates are easily scheduled or handled manually and you gotta love the price-tag.
Sgear, you can also d/l the signatures via FTP by going to ftp.symantec.com then navigate through the public/english_us_canada/antivirus_definitions/norton_antivirus and download the current *-x86.exe file and all should be well. As for why your system is not updating - who knows? How old is the software? Did your license possibly expire? If you are trying to run LiveUpdate are you behind a proxy? Is your firewall blocking you? Is the config correct and pointing to the Symantec LiveUpdate site?
You can also check the knowledge base (under support) for the problems you are having and may find a workable solution fairly soon.
